Cheapest Available North Edmonds 2 Bedroom Apartments

Currently the lowest priced 2 Bedroom apartment unit North Edmonds of Seattle, WA is the 2b1b-710 Model starting from $1,695 at Horizon Park Apartments. The average price for all 2 Bedroom apartments in North Edmonds is currently $2,078. Here is today’s list of the cheapest available 2 Bedroom options in the area:

Quick Rent Budget Calculator

How much rent can you afford?

The common "Rule of Thumb" is that rent should be no more than 30% of your income. How much is that? Enter your monthly income and click "Calculate My Budget" to find out.
